The final price for painting your home depends on a few practical factors. First, the total surface area and the number of stories play a big role. If your exterior needs heavy prep work—like scraping loose paint, repairing wood rot, or pressure washing stubborn mildew—that adds time and labor. The type of materials matters, too; painting stucco is a different process than siding or brick. We also look at the quality of the paint you select and how many coats are needed to get the finish you want.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

Summer offers the best conditions for painting because the weather stays consistently warm and dry. This allows the paint to cure properly and prevents issues with moisture trapped under the coat. For Des Moines exteriors, a high-quality acrylic latex paint is recommended. It offers excellent adhesion, flexibility to handle temperature changes, and resistance to moisture and fading. The pros can suggest the best products for your home's specific materials.
